Cape Schanck Lighthouse marks the beginning of the Coastal Stroll. Lisa Holmen Photography/ShutterstockLauren and I love our long-distance walks, so you can imagine exactly how vibrantly our eyes lit up when we found the presence of the Mornington Peninsula's Coastal Stroll. This 30 kilometres trail runs along the ocean side of the peninsula between Cape Schanck and the Point Nepean National Park, and is itself part of the 100 km Mornington Peninsula loop walk.

The quarantine station is well worth an appearance, with over forty buildings stretched out over a wide verdant area that were constructed from the 1850s forward to take care of new kid on the blocks with influenza, leprosy, and various other transmittable illness. At the other end of the park, at the very idea of the Mornington Peninsula, exists Fort Nepean.


On my last see I mostly complied with this course, beginning and finishing at the primary car park and took in the quarantine centre, browse this site Fort Nepean, London Bridge, and numerous various other factors of passion. All photos copyright Whatever Victoria unless otherwise kept in mind.


Further out on the Peninsula, towards its suggestion at Point Nepean, Victoria's Quarantine Station operated for over 100 years (and is currently open up to the general public). Factor Nepean additionally houses Ft Nepean, a network of fortifications, gun emplacements and barracks built to safeguard the entryway to Port Phillip.
